Ukraine. A.G.R.Group landbank grows to 33 thou. ha
Chernukhinsky Krai, a subsidiary of Misak Khidiryan’s A.G.R. Group, acquired the corporate rights to Sigma-Universal, a company operating in the north of Sumy region, in Seredyna-Buda district.
Through the acquisition of the company, A.G.R. Group has increased its land bank by 1,52 thou. ha to almost 33 thou. ha.
Twelve employees and 403 land share owners working with Sigma-Universal also joined the holding company.
